From 8th 18th century bhakti movement, islam and sufi movement played an important role in the history of medieval india. the alvars and the nayanars were considered as the founder of bhakti movement in southern india. the alvars were the devotees of lord vishnu, while the nayanars followed shaivism.

Both traditions emphasized devotion (bhakti) to a chosen deity, envisioning a loving bond between devotees and their gods. in vaishnavism, various cults formed around the avatars or incarnations of vishnu. ten avatars were recognized, believed to manifest whenever the world faced threats from evil forces.
